How far is Nam Dinh from Hanoi?

Nam Dinh is approximately 90 to 100 kilometers southeast of Hanoi, with a travel time of about 1.5 to 2 hours by car or train.

Are there temples or pagodas to visit in Nam Dinh?

Yes, Nam Dinh is famous for its temples and pagodas, including Phu Nhai Pagoda and Keo Pagoda, which are important religious and cultural sites.

What kind of weather does Nam Dinh have?

Nam Dinh has a humid subtropical climate with hot, rainy summers and mild, dry winters. The weather varies throughout the year, with the hottest months from June to August.

Why Nam Dinh Should Be on Your Travel Radar

Nam Dinh is a city steeped in history and culture, making it a compelling destination for travelers seeking an authentic Vietnamese experience. One of the city’s most notable features is its historical significance as a former capital of Vietnam. This rich heritage is evident in its many temples and monuments, such as the Tran Temple, which honors the Tran Dynasty, known for its victories against Mongol invasions. Exploring these historical sites provides insight into the resilience and spirit of the Vietnamese people.

In addition to its historical attractions, Nam Dinh boasts a vibrant cultural scene. The city is famous for its traditional festivals, such as the Tran Temple Festival, held annually to celebrate the Tran Dynasty's legacy. During this lively event, visitors can witness traditional music, dance performances, and local cuisine, all while mingling with friendly locals eager to share their customs. This festival is a perfect opportunity to immerse yourself in the local culture and create lasting memories.

Food lovers will also find plenty to enjoy in Nam Dinh. The city is renowned for its delicious local dishes, including Nam Dinh rice, known for its unique flavor and texture, and Gio Lua, a type of Vietnamese pork sausage that is a must-try. Sampling these culinary delights at local eateries adds another layer to your travel experience, allowing you to connect with the region's rich gastronomic heritage.

Transportation Details for Easy Travel in Nam Dinh

Getting to and around Nam Dinh is straightforward, thanks to its well-connected transportation system. The city is accessible via the Nam Dinh Bus Station, which offers services from major cities like Hanoi. Buses are a cost-effective way to travel, with frequent departures throughout the day. For those flying in, the nearest airport is Cat Bi International Airport in Hai Phong, approximately 90 kilometers away. From there, travelers can take a taxi or shuttle bus to reach Nam Dinh.

Once in the city, public transportation options include buses and taxis. Local buses are an affordable way to navigate the city, though they may not always have English signage. For a more comfortable experience, registered taxis are readily available and provide a convenient way to reach your desired destination. Using ride-sharing apps can also be a reliable option for those who prefer a more modern approach to transportation.
